Original artwork description:

I love the blue, the blue wood, the blue sky, sultry, languid, houses of former grandeur, elegant, exotic. Hints of mystery, of ghosts and spirits and spice. A wonderful souvenir of New Orleans and a great addition to any collection of Americana.

Texture has been added to create extra depth. The canvas is 0.5 inches deep and can therefore hang without a frame if wished.

Materials used:

acrylic and card
